Hiking Trails and Viewpoints of Banff is a practical, experience-driven guide to exploring one of the most breathtaking landscapes in the Canadian Rockies. Designed for both first-time visitors and seasoned hikers, this book blends trail knowledge, planning insight, and on-the-ground realism to help readers experience Banff National Park with confidence and clarity.Banff is more than a collection of famous lakes and postcard views—it is a living network of trails, alpine terrain, forests, and viewpoints that change with elevation, season, and weather. This guide walks readers through that complexity in a clear, structured way, helping them understand not just where to hike, but how to prepare, what to expect, and how to move through the park safely and responsibly.Inside, readers will find:Detailed explanations of Banff’s terrain, climate, and seasonal hiking conditionsGuidance on selecting trails based on skill level, distance, elevation gain, and timePractical advice on essential gear, footwear, clothing, hydration, and backpack systemsTrail techniques for navigating ascents, descents, switchbacks, and uneven groundSafety awareness covering weather changes, wildlife encounters, and common trail hazardsCoverage of well-known routes and scenic viewpoints, from accessible walks to more demanding hikesInsights into trail etiquette, conservation awareness, and respectful hiking practicesHelpful sections on nutrition, mental endurance, recovery, and multi-day hiking preparationContext on Banff’s natural history, flora and fauna, and cultural significanceRather than rushing readers through a checklist of trails, this book focuses on helping hikers make informed decisions before and during each outing. The result is a guide that supports safer planning, deeper appreciation of the landscape, and more rewarding time on the trail.Written in a clear, encouraging tone, this guide serves as both a field reference and a preparation companion—ideal for day hikers, outdoor enthusiasts, photographers, and travelers who want to experience Banff beyond the overlooks while respecting the realities of mountain environments.This guide is for those who value preparation, awareness, and the quiet satisfaction that comes from moving through wild places with intention.
